What’s the Deal with a Joint Services Transcript?

Now, if you’ve served in the military, you may have heard about the joint services transcript (JST). But what exactly is it? In a nutshell, it’s an official document that records your military training and coursework. Basically, it’s like a report card that showcases all the valuable skills you gained while serving. Oregon Cosmetology Laws: What You Should Know

Now that we’ve covered the importance of your JST, it’s time to familiarize yourself with the specific state laws surrounding cosmetology. Oregon is known for its rigor in maintaining high standards, essential for ensuring clients receive top-notch service. Here are some important aspects:

  • Training Requirement: To become licensed, you need to complete a set number of hours at an accredited beauty school. This varies by specialty, whether you're diving into hair, nails, or skincare.

  • Examinations: After training, passing state exams is necessary to demonstrate your ability. They typically cover theory and practical skills to ensure you’re well-rounded in your craft.

  • Continuing Education: Keeping your license active requires ongoing education. Oregon encourages licensed cosmetologists to stay updated on the latest trends, techniques, and safety protocols. After all, the beauty industry is always evolving, and staying ahead is crucial.
